I first started collecting clocks about 10 years ago and i was a sellers Dream come true. I bought any and everything junk, fake, reproduction clocks I was the worst collector. I am happy to say after now collecting a total of about 900 clocks I have become much better at selecting quality and infact "REAL ANTIQUE" clocks. My obsession began when I found a Ballerina Clock on Ebay and thought to myself, "Oh my gawd", that's the same clock my Irish Grandmother had on her sideboard that I broke and it took ages for her to forgive me. "sheesh I was only 8 years old. Anyway after that the clock bug kicked in. I am happy to say I have refined further collecting down to JUST Jema Holland Clocks now. Once I purchased my first Jema Clock being the Black Panther I was in love. The maker as I have learned is not well known and sadly has vanished without a trace as far as history and true ledgers of how many Jema Holland Clocks were really made. For now Jema collectors like me are just guessing on random information we share between us that we have found in some sites. I have now actually communicated with the daughter of the maker who sadly had very little information to date to share with me. It is believed there is at least 80 different Jema clocks that were made but that hasn'r been 100% confirmed. I have now about 120 Jema Holland Clocks of which i have about 56 different ones. I have photos of 10 I am yet to find "sad face".... which means there is at least 14 more different Jema Clocks out that that are "Unknown" re their number or what they are.. IE: Budgies, Cats and so on. My dream one day sooner rather than later is to somehow miraculously come across the lost Jema's and proudly say I believe I now have a complete Jema Holland Clock Collection. It excites me that I like others are so passionate out these clocks and that we do it to hopefully leave for future generations what beautiful work was done by Jema back in the 1940's.
